JK Rowling's 1st Edition Harry Potter and the Goblet of Fire, UK copy complete with dust jacket.

Famous publishing mistake on page 503 reading...…. 'Dumbledore, come! said Crouch angrily.' but Fudge should of said this and is corrected in later editions.

Page 594 says 'The imperius curse, Moody said', but Crouch should of said this and again this is corrected in later editions.

This is the Bloomsbury 1st UK edition, 1st print published in 2000, highly collectable and sought after unlike the Ted Smart book club edition which have little value.
